4′-Chloropropiophenone
4′-Chloropropiophenone (CAS: 6285-05-8) is an organic compound with the formula ClC6H4COC2H5 and a molecular weight of 168.62 g/mol. This propiophenone derivative features a chlorine atom on the phenyl ring and a ketone functional group. It serves as a valuable intermediate in organic synthesis, particularly in the preparation of more complex molecules. Its chemical structure makes it a useful building block for various research and development applications within the chemical industry.

| Molecular weight | 168.62 |
|---|---|
| Linear formula | ClC6H4COC2H5 |
| Assay | 98% |
| Boiling point | 95-97 °C/1 mmHg(lit.) |
| Melting point | 35-37 °C(lit.) |
| Protective equipment | Eyeshields, Gloves, type N95 (US), type P1 (EN143) respirator filter |
|---|---|
| Flash point | >113 °C / >235.4 °F |
| Water hazard class (WGK, DE) | 3 |
